If you get an email with the topic AHINFO with a zip attachment and the message says something to the effect of <I send this file to you please, check it out for me> dont open it.
Got a warning from a former squadie-
According to Norton Antivirus 2001, the virus was "W32.Sircam.Worm@mm" in
both messages. For information about this virus, check this page from
McAfee:
http://www.mcafee.com/anti-virus/viruses/sircam/default.asp?cid=2360 (http://www.mcafee.com/anti-virus/viruses/sircam/default.asp?cid=2360)
I got 2 seperate emails containing the same message header and attachment, as did at least 3 other squadies.
